Magic Twister

by Tist de Ruiter in Circuits > Microcontrollers

61 Views, 0 Favorites, 0 Comments

Magic Twister

add15d01-d481-4152-b4f5-a953e10a85c6.jpg

Met de Magic Twister kun je een vraag stellen en een antwoord zal aangeduid worden. Maar hiervoor moet de Microbit wel naar het noorden gericht worden, anders zal hij niet werken.

Kom mee in het avontuur en ontwerp je eigen Magic Twister. Ik voeg altijd een voorbeeld toe zodat je een houvast hebt.

Supplies

0ef739d7-e89b-470f-98f0-50d2618bd7cb.jpg

De dingen die je zult nodig hebben zijn:

  • Een BBC micro:bit
  • Een Inventors kit voor de micro:bit
  • Een lasercutter (ik gebruik de Laserbox)
  • Een computer
  • Dunne plaat hout
  • Beam Studio (app)

De Code

magic twister coding 1.JPG
magic twister coding 3.JPG
e973f79feefc2256a679c0853b2f2c09.jpg

We beginnen met het coderen van de Magic Twister. We gebruiken de website Microbit Makecode.

Wat willen juist maken? Een programma waarmee je eerst naar het noorden moet wijzen met de Microbit voordat je op de knop kan drukken om de pijl te doen draaien.

Je zult zien dat er getallen in de code staan, die dienen om te bepalen waar het noorden juist is. Om altijd het noorden te blijven aanduiden en/of te tonen naar welke kant je moet draaien, komen er pijlen die in de juiste richting wijzen.

De eerste foto van de code is om de motor te doen draaien.

De motor zal een willekeurig aantal toertjes draaien, aan de hand van hoeveel kracht er door de motor gaat zal ze op een onbepaald moment stoppen.

Breadboard

breadboard setup magic twister.jpg
parts magic twister.jpg
1513ae15-ce5b-4617-9720-0fc3f54b5177.jpg

We gaan nu de Microbit verbinden met de motor, hier hebben we een aantal onderdelen voor nodig.

Aan bovenstaande foto's kun je zien hoe het in zijn werking gaat.

Lasercutten

700953fa-9598-4a1f-8666-1d2f7c07bf95.jpg

Als 2de stap gaan we lasercutten. We maken een schijf waar verschillende woorden op staan die als antwoorden zullen dienen. Ook maken we een pijltje dat het antwoord zal aanduiden.

In de bijlage vind je het bestand om rechtstreeks uit te snijden en te graveren.

Mijn schijf heeft een diameter van 200 mm de cirkel in het midden heeft een diameter van 25 mm.

De grootte van het pijltje mag je zelf kiezen. De ideale groote voor het gaatje waar de motor as door moet is 1,7 mm.

Verbindt de app met je lasercutter en druk linksboven op de camera om een gebied te selecteren waar je op zal werken. Sleep het volledige model op de juiste plaats waar je zo min mogelijk hout zal verspillen. Kies per laag wat je wilt graveren en wat je wilt uitsnijden.

Druk rechtsboven op 'GO' om het process te starten.


Als het klaar is met cutten haal je de vormen uit de machine. Je kunt de randen eventueel nog bijschuren als het gat voor de motor te klein is. Als je te veel hebt weggeschuurd kun je dit eenvoudig oplossen door een stukje schilderstape rondom de motor te wikkelen zodat het net past.

Het Samenvoegen

4ef2c405-1991-44df-ae45-a8f06aa56ae0 (1).jpg

Steek de motor door de grote plaat zodat hij stevig vast zit. Plaats het pijltje op de roterende as van de motor. Ook stevig anders draait hij niet goed.

Verbind de motor langs onder met de voorziene kabels en leg de Microbit goed zichtbaar.